Skip to main content

Security Programmer

Menomonee Falls, WI
Permanent

Posted

RIGHTECH is a leading nationwide provider of technical staffing services, and we are currently seeking qualified candidates for a Security Programmer in Menomonee Falls, WI starting as soon as possible.

Job Title: Security Programmer

Location: Menomonee Falls, WI (30 minutes north of Milwaukee)
Open to relocation

Duration: Direct Hire

Start Date: ASAP

Job Description:
  • Lead access control programming, VMS configuration support, integration testing, commissioning, and technical turnover activities for complex security systems.
  • Review drawings, specifications, submittals, door schedules, device schedules, sequence-of-operation narratives, network requirements, and project scope to identify technical gaps before field execution.
  • Configure, program, test, troubleshoot, and validate enterprise access control systems in accordance with approved design documents, customer standards, manufacturer requirements, and project expectations.
  • Program and validate cardholders, access levels, schedules, holidays, door modes, alarms, events, input/output linking, interlocks, anti-passback, elevator/floor control, intrusion interfaces, and reporting requirements.
  • Support VMS setup and validation where required, including camera configuration, recording schedules, events, user permissions, maps/views, health monitoring, retention settings, and system troubleshooting.
  • Coordinate technical work with the PM, FPM, field technicians, subcontractors, customer security teams, customer IT teams, manufacturers, consultants, and other trades.
  • Lead or support point-to-point checkout, pre-functional testing, functional testing, scenario testing, integrated systems testing, customer demonstrations, and acceptance testing.
  • Troubleshoot hardware, firmware, software, database, licensing, credential, network, certificate, integration, and system performance issues through a documented and disciplined process.
  • Maintain accurate commissioning documentation, deficiency logs, test records, redlines, network information, controller/device information, firmware/software versions, backup records, and turnover notes.
  • Support schedule performance by identifying technical blockers early, communicating risks clearly, escalating issues appropriately, and helping the project team remove constraints before they impact turnover.
  • Support project financial performance by reducing rework, documenting scope gaps and change conditions, using technical time efficiently, and preventing unresolved technical issues from drifting into closeout.
  • Mentor technicians and junior specialists on programming expectations, commissioning methods, troubleshooting logic, documentation standards, and safe work practices.
  • Represent Convergint professionally with customers, consultants, inspectors, IT stakeholders, manufacturers, subcontractors, and internal leadership.

Job Type: Permanent

Job ID: 255047951